Curriculum vitae
Alexander Deublein graduated with a bachelor’s and master’s degree in Electrical Engineering from FAU Erlangen-Nuremberg in August 2018 and April 2021. Since June 2021, he has been working as a research associate at the Institute for Electronics Engineering, focusing on RF power amplifiers.
Research areas
- RF circuit design
- RF power amplifiers
Awards
- 2023: IEEE MTT-S International Microwave Symposium Student Design Competition First Place Award in the category "High-Efficiency Power Amplifier" (IEEE Microwave Theory & Technology Society (MTT-S))
- 2022: IEEE MTT-S International Microwave Symposium Student Design Competition First Place Award in the category "High-Efficiency Power Amplifier" (IEEE Microwave Theory & Technology Society (MTT-S))
